Oct. 5, 2010 - PRLog -- BPO or Business process outsourcing is actually the contracting of a particular service to a third party service provider. It is accounted to be the most cost-saving method undertaken by a company to establish its’ name in the market. And Bpo services in India have skillfully extended its horizons catering to the vast western operations of multinational firms.

According to recent statistics, an estimated 0.7 million people are working in the outsourcing sector. The annual revenues are around $11 billion, which is approximately around 1% of the GDP. Every year, more people graduate in India, and since Bpo sector provides ample job opportunities, the youths are extremely attracted towards this field. Apart from high employment quotient, this sector also provides high wages to its employees…which is yet another “hit the jackpot” feature.

BPO has frequently been referred to as an ITES or Information Technology-Enabled Service industry since most of its business processes include some form of automation, as IT “enables” these services to be performed. After tasting the great success of Bpo companies, another offshoot of the same called KPO (Knowledge Process Outsourcing) has emerged. KPO activities require greater skill, knowledge, education and expertise to handle. It encompasses R&D, product development and legal e-discovery, as well as a number of other business functions. Apart from this, another term, which is greatly being used, is BTO –Business Transforming Outsourcing.
